Most Meta accounts aren't underperforming because of budget. They're underperforming because nobody's reading the data that actually matters.
CTR tells you if the hook is landing. CPC tells you if the audience is right. LPV tells you if your site is even working. ATC tells you if the offer is doing its job. Every drop-off in that chain is telling you exactly where to look.

Account structure
How we structure the ad account for long-term growth
Every Meta account should be running three layers at once → not just sales campaigns. TOF brings in new people, MOF warms them up, BOF converts them. Each layer has a different objective, a different audience, and a different budget. Miss one and the whole system stalls.
Top of funnel
Find new people
Cold audiences who have never heard of you. Your job at TOF is reach → get in front of as many qualified strangers as possible.

Middle of funnel
Warm them up
People who have seen your content, visited your site, or engaged with your posts. They know you → they just haven't bought yet.

Bottom of funnel
Convert and retain
Highest intent → add to carts, checkout initiators, and past buyers. Smallest pool but most likely to buy. Don't overspend here.

How the system compounds over time
TOF fills the pool. MOF warms the pool. BOF converts the pool. Each layer feeds the next → skip one and the whole thing stalls.
